have a 1998 ES300 and would like to know how to find out which model will work obd2?
already tested two types and nothing working.

Your 1998 es300 is OBD 2 compliant, so any OBD 2 compliant code reader will work with your car.

What exactly are you doing, and what's not working?

I can't speak for other models, but those particular models are known to be totally unreliable. They either dont work straight out of the box, or fail shortly thereafter. Do a google search. There are also numerous issues with the supplied software. So at minimum you'll need to purchase a better software for that particular model.

If you can, get your money back and buy a traditional OBD-2 code reader, or scanner.

I bought this one for $22 last year. Works great with Torque. Even though my bluetooth was on, it needed standalone GPS services on as well to connect. Let us know.
